How We Handle Residential Water Removal

The first few hours after a water damage incident are critical. That’s why our team springs into action, deploying our specialized equipment to extract the water and begin the drying process. We’ll work closely with you to assess the damage, identify potential hazards, and create a customized plan to get your home back to normal.

Step 1: Water Extraction

Our team uses state-of-the-art water extraction equipment, including truck-mounted pumps and wet vacuums, to remove as much water as possible from your home. This is often the most critical step in the process, as it finds out the success of the entire operation. We’ll work quickly to extract as much water as possible, using techniques like vacuum extraction and squeegee removal.

Step 2: Drying and Dehumidification

After the water has been extracted, we’ll use specialized drying equipment, including dehumidifiers and air movers, to dry out your home. This is a crucial step, as it helps prevent further damage and reduces the risk of mold growth.

Step 3: Sanitizing and Disinfecting

Once the drying process is complete, our team will sanitize and disinfect your home to remove any remaining moisture and bacteria. This includes using specialized equipment like ozone generators and UV light sanitizers.

Step 4: Reconstruction and Repair

Finally, we’ll work with you to repair and reconstruct any damaged areas of your home, including drywall, flooring, and structural elements. Our team is skilled in a wide range of reconstruction techniques, from minor repairs to major renovations.

Residential Water Removal Cost in Weatherford, TX

The cost of residential water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Weatherford, TX. These are estimates, not guarantees. Our team will work closely with you to assess the damage and create a customized plan to get your home back to normal.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ction $500 – $2,500 The amount of water, the size of the affected area, and the location of the water damage.
Drying and d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 The size of the affected area, the type of equipment used, and the duration of the drying process.
Sanitizing and disinfecting $500 – $2,000 The size of the affected area, the type of equipment used, and the duration of the sanitizing process.
Reconstruction and repair $2,000 – $10,000 The extent of the damage, the type of materials used, and the duration of the repair process.
